The number of city blocks in 1000 feet can vary depending on the city and its block size. In a typical city where each block is around 200 feet long, there would be approximately 5 city blocks in 1000 feet. However, in cities with smaller blocks, there could be more blocks in the same distance. It is important to consider the specific city's block size when calculating the number of blocks in a given distance.

How many blocks equal a mile?

Each city may have a different number of blocks in a mile, as they independently determine the size of their city blocks. There is no universal or standard size for city blocks. To determine how many blocks are equal to one mile, you first need to find the size of the blocks in the city you are asking about, and do the math.5,280 feet equals one mile. To find out how many city blocks would equal a mile, divide 5,280 feet by the number of feet in a block in the city in question.For example, the blocks in Tucson, Arizona are 400 feet long. Diving 5,280 by 400 means that 13.2 blocks would equal 1 mile.Another example, there are long blocks from east to west and short blocks from north to south in Manhattan. There are 20 short blocks in one mile.Depending upon where you are, there are approximately 20 city blocks to one mile.
